About This Community

Owners at Highlands Poa pay about $250 per month ($3,000 annually) in HOA dues. The community is a planned development in Savannah, GA (ZIP 31401). Shared amenities include Dog Park, Walking Trails. Rentals are not currently permitted under the CC&Rs. The community is pet-friendly.

Smart buyers always request the current CC&Rs, the most recent reserve study, and 24 months of board minutes before closing on any HOA-governed home.
